Inside the unique package, you`ll find accessories to get you started, including three mini traffic cones and six mini bowling pins, as well as a charging cable for the robot. It connects to the Sphero Edu app or Sphero Mini app via Bluetooth and allows students to program in three different modes: drawing, scratch, and JavaScript.

Our favorite aspect of the Sphero Mini is that it is fully compatible with the Sphero Edu app. It enables the same programming experiences that students get with the BOLT for less than half the price, making it one of the most affordable robots for teaching. To exit the power off, plug in your Mini, wait for the LED light to turn on, and then launch the app. The device pairs securely via Bluetooth, which does not require a password. Sphero Mini can be used with both Sphero Play (which has no user account and therefore no password) and Sphero Edu (which supports a variety of usage options ranging from no login to integration with third-party authentication services with their own password policies). It has faster acceleration than something like a Sphero BOLT. If you`re having trouble connecting via Bluetooth, first make sure your device is compatible. If you`re still having problems, make sure Bluetooth is enabled on your device and make sure you`re within the 10-meter range (it`s often best to hold the robot right next to the device).

If you`re using an Android device, you`ll also need to turn on your location services. However, you don`t need to pair the robot in the device`s Bluetooth menu – just hold the robot next to your device and it will connect automatically. 1. Sphero Mini has two different power modes, Power Off and Standby. Depending on the power mode your Mini is in, you`ll need to activate it differently. The original Sphero Mini features some of the same sensors as the Sphero BOLT, including motor encoders, gyroscope, and accelerometer, as well as LED lights that students can manipulate with code. However, this is the size of a ping-pong ball. For comparison: BOLT is about the size of a baseball. You can tell the difference between the original Sphero mini robot and the new version simply by their colors. The originals are white on the outside with a blue, green, pink or orange stripe. The new version, on the other hand, is quite clear. The Mini can travel up to 2.2 mph or 1 meter per second, about half the top speed of the BOLT. It is perfect for indoor use on hard floors or with very thin carpets, while BOLT can be used outdoors and through dirt, water and paint. If your robot disconnects from your device when you plug it in, it`s completely normal because it`s designed to reset when you plug it in. You can log back in after a few seconds. However, make sure students record their progress when they play one of the Sphero Mini games when they plug in their Mini, or they lose what they`ve done. If your connection problem persists, follow the instructions below: Unlike the Bolt, the Mini is not a waterproof robot and is therefore not waterproof. Its outer shell is made of plastic and can break if hit or broken. The Sphero team recommends never dropping the Mini more than a few centimeters, even if it is resistant. There are no questions. Be the first to ask a question! To charge the Sphero Mini, first remove the outer cover and use the included micro-USB charging cable. It takes about an hour to fully charge the Mini for up to 45 minutes of continuous play, allowing students to use their programming time more efficiently. You know the Mini needs to be charged when its LEDs flash red. You will also see a low battery warning on your device`s screen. You can check the battery level at any time in the app at the top of the player screen. It can be controlled via the Sphero Edu or Sphero Play apps, both of which are free.
